Congress rejects J&K exit poll results

December 22, 2014 01:49 am | Updated November 16, 2021 07:07 pm IST - Jammu:

The Congress on Sunday described as “baseless and unscientific” the exit polls results that predicted a washout of the party in the Jammu and Kashmir Assembly elections,

Congress spokesperson Salman Nizami said the exit polls were an attempt to mislead the people and demoralise party candidates and workers.

He said the Congress was confident of forming the next government in the State. “The survey conducted is unscientific as it has taken into consideration a small sample from only urban areas of the State, whereas rural areas have been completely ignored,” he said.
